package maintenance
import (
"context"
"fmt"
"os"
"path/filepath"
"time"
"yellowjacket/backend/database"
)
// Retention windows for cache data. Cached artwork for artists the user
// actually owns is kept indefinitely; art fetched while browsing Explore
// is transient and ages out.
const (
// browsedArtRetention is how long artwork for a non-library artist
// survives after it was fetched.
browsedArtRetention = 90 * 24 * time.Hour
// proxyCacheRetention is how long an Explore cover-art thumbnail
// survives after it was last written.
proxyCacheRetention = 30 * 24 * time.Hour
)
// Default intervals. These are minimums, not schedules — the runner
// skips a job that ran more recently.
const (
frequentInterval = 6 * time.Hour
dailyInterval = 24 * time.Hour
)
// ExpiredHTTPCacheJob deletes HTTP cache rows past their TTL.
//
// Reads already filter on expires_at, so expired rows are inert — but
// nothing was deleting them, so the table grew without bound for the
// life of the install.
func ExpiredHTTPCacheJob(db *database.DB) Job {
return Job{
Name: "http-cache-evict",
MinInterval: frequentInterval,
Run: func(_ context.Context) (Result, error) {
res, err := db.ExecContext(
"DELETE FROM http_cache WHERE expires_at < datetime('now')",
)
if err != nil {
return Result{}, fmt.Errorf(
"delete expired http_cache rows: %w", err,
)
}
rows, _ := res.RowsAffected()
return Result{RowsDeleted: rows}, nil
},
}
}
// OrphanedCoverFilesJob removes files from the covers directory that no
// cover_art row references.
//
// Cover art is derived data, so the live set is authoritative: every
// file that is not the original named by a cover_art row, or one of that
// original's derived size variants, is garbage. This reclaims art left
// behind by earlier versions that deleted only the original and left its
// thumbnails.
func OrphanedCoverFilesJob(
db *database.DB,
coversDir string,
expandVariants func(originalPath string) []string,
) Job {
return Job{
Name: "covers-sweep",
MinInterval: dailyInterval,
Run: func(ctx context.Context) (Result, error) {
live, err := liveCoverFiles(db, coversDir, expandVariants)
if err != nil {
return Result{}, err
}
// A covers directory with no live entries almost certainly
// means the query failed to see the real table rather than
// that every cover is garbage. Refuse to empty the
// directory on that basis.
if len(live) == 0 {
return Result{}, nil
}
return sweepDir(ctx, coversDir, func(name string) bool {
return !live[name]
})
},
}
}
// liveCoverFiles returns the basenames of every file the covers
// directory is supposed to contain.
func liveCoverFiles(
db *database.DB,
coversDir string,
expandVariants func(string) []string,
) (map[string]bool, error) {
rows, err := db.QueryContext("SELECT file_path FROM cover_art")
if err != nil {
return nil, fmt.Errorf("read cover_art paths: %w", err)
}
defer func() { _ = rows.Close() }()
live := make(map[string]bool)
for rows.Next() {
var path string
if err := rows.Scan(&path); err != nil {
return nil, fmt.Errorf("scan cover_art path: %w", err)
}
// Rows may store an absolute path from a previous install
// location, so compare by basename within the covers directory.
original := filepath.Join(coversDir, filepath.Base(path))
for _, variant := range expandVariants(original) {
live[filepath.Base(variant)] = true
}
}
if err := rows.Err(); err != nil {
return nil, fmt.Errorf("iterate cover_art paths: %w", err)
}
return live, nil
}
// OrphanedArtistImagesJob evicts cached artist artwork.
//
// Artist images are cache data with no owner to compare against — they
// are fetched for any artist the user browses in Explore, most of whom
// are not in the library. The policy is therefore twofold: artwork for
// an artist the user owns is kept indefinitely, and everything else ages
// out. Rows whose file has vanished are dropped so the table matches
// what is actually on disk.
func OrphanedArtistImagesJob(db *database.DB, artistImagesDir string) Job {
return Job{
Name: "artist-images-sweep",
MinInterval: dailyInterval,
Run: func(ctx context.Context) (Result, error) {
var result Result
cutoff := time.Now().Add(-browsedArtRetention)
// Collect the directories to remove before deleting rows, so
// a failure partway leaves rows pointing at real files
// rather than the reverse.
stale, err := staleArtistMBIDs(db, cutoff)
if err != nil {
return Result{}, err
}
for _, mbid := range stale {
if ctx.Err() != nil {
return result, nil
}
dir := filepath.Join(artistImagesDir, mbid)
freed, files := dirSize(dir)
if err := os.RemoveAll(dir); err != nil && !os.IsNotExist(err) {
continue
}
result.FilesDeleted += files
result.BytesFreed += freed
}
if len(stale) > 0 {
rows, delErr := deleteArtistImageRows(db, stale)
if delErr != nil {
return result, delErr
}
result.RowsDeleted += rows
}
return result, nil
},
}
}
// staleArtistMBIDs returns artist MBIDs whose cached artwork may be
// evicted: fetched before the cutoff and not an artist in the library.
func staleArtistMBIDs(
db *database.DB,
cutoff time.Time,
) ([]string, error) {
rows, err := db.QueryContext(
`SELECT DISTINCT artist_mbid FROM artist_images
WHERE created_at < ?
AND artist_mbid NOT IN (
SELECT mbid FROM artists
WHERE mbid IS NOT NULL AND mbid != ''
)`,
cutoff,
)
if err != nil {
return nil, fmt.Errorf("query stale artist images: %w", err)
}
defer func() { _ = rows.Close() }()
var mbids []string
for rows.Next() {
var mbid string
if err := rows.Scan(&mbid); err != nil {
return nil, fmt.Errorf("scan artist mbid: %w", err)
}
if mbid != "" {
mbids = append(mbids, mbid)
}
}
if err := rows.Err(); err != nil {
return nil, fmt.Errorf("iterate stale artist images: %w", err)
}
return mbids, nil
}
// deleteArtistImageRows removes the rows for the given artist MBIDs.
func deleteArtistImageRows(
db *database.DB,
mbids []string,
) (int64, error) {
var total int64
for _, mbid := range mbids {
res, err := db.ExecContext(
"DELETE FROM artist_images WHERE artist_mbid = ?", mbid,
)
if err != nil {
return total, fmt.Errorf(
"delete artist_images rows for %s: %w", mbid, err,
)
}
n, _ := res.RowsAffected()
total += n
}
return total, nil
}
// ExpiredProxyCacheJob evicts Explore cover-art thumbnails that have not
// been rewritten within the retention window.
//
// This cache has no database table at all — it is keyed by release-group
// MBID on the filesystem — so age is the only signal available.
func ExpiredProxyCacheJob(proxyCacheDir string) Job {
return Job{
Name: "cover-art-proxy-sweep",
MinInterval: dailyInterval,
Run: func(ctx context.Context) (Result, error) {
cutoff := time.Now().Add(-proxyCacheRetention)
return sweepDirFunc(ctx, proxyCacheDir,
func(_ string, info os.FileInfo) bool {
return info.ModTime().Before(cutoff)
},
)
},
}
}
// sweepDir removes every file in dir for which shouldDelete reports true.
func sweepDir(
ctx context.Context,
dir string,
shouldDelete func(name string) bool,
) (Result, error) {
return sweepDirFunc(ctx, dir, func(name string, _ os.FileInfo) bool {
return shouldDelete(name)
})
}
// sweepDirFunc removes files from a flat directory based on a predicate
// over the name and stat info. Subdirectories are left alone; sweeps
// that own directory trees handle them explicitly.
func sweepDirFunc(
ctx context.Context,
dir string,
shouldDelete func(name string, info os.FileInfo) bool,
) (Result, error) {
entries, err := os.ReadDir(dir)
if err != nil {
if os.IsNotExist(err) {
return Result{}, nil
}
return Result{}, fmt.Errorf("read %s: %w", dir, err)
}
var result Result
for _, entry := range entries {
if ctx.Err() != nil {
return result, nil
}
if entry.IsDir() {
continue
}
info, infoErr := entry.Info()
if infoErr != nil {
continue
}
if !shouldDelete(entry.Name(), info) {
continue
}
if err := os.Remove(filepath.Join(dir, entry.Name())); err != nil {
continue
}
result.FilesDeleted++
result.BytesFreed += info.Size()
}
return result, nil
}
// dirSize totals the files in a directory tree.
func dirSize(dir string) (bytes, files int64) {
_ = filepath.WalkDir(dir, func(_ string, d os.DirEntry, err error) error {
if err != nil || d.IsDir() {
return nil //nolint:nilerr // best-effort accounting
}
info, infoErr := d.Info()
if infoErr != nil {
return nil
}
bytes += info.Size()
files++
return nil
})
return bytes, files
}
